In 2010, Lebanese comedian Wissam Kamal was performing in a university. During his performance, he noticed a deaf girl laughing. When he asks her friends, they explain that she either read his lips, or they were translating the show for her in sign language, and a dream was born. He decides that one day he will learn sign language, and he will perform a stand-up comedy show in sign language, exclusively for the deaf community.
